Output e7362a183993dec85ccd6e6424bfeb4a5b13cdb4a2b54bd9b558d4058ea4814a:21

value
53262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70b443145d72f02a6bc5cf2ffbee8ffe45bf1107 OP_EQUAL
address
3BxwYrVbcrcQT3mptCPXkaTKf1iyEngMPh
transaction
e7362a183993dec85ccd6e6424bfeb4a5b13cdb4a2b54bd9b558d4058ea4814a
spent
true